Signaalanalyse over lichtnet
Wij hanteren het label Open Access voor onderzoek met een Creative Commons licentie. Door een CC-licentie toe te kennen, geeft de auteur toestemming aan anderen om zijn of haar werk te verspreiden, te delen of te bewerken. Voor meer informatie over wat de verschillende CC-licenties inhouden, klik op het CC-icoon. Alle rechten voorbehouden wordt gebruikt voor publicaties waar enkel de auteurswet op van toepassing is.
Signaalanalyse over lichtnet
Wij hanteren het label Open Access voor onderzoek met een Creative Commons licentie. Door een CC-licentie toe te kennen, geeft de auteur toestemming aan anderen om zijn of haar werk te verspreiden, te delen of te bewerken. Voor meer informatie over wat de verschillende CC-licenties inhouden, klik op het CC-icoon. Alle rechten voorbehouden wordt gebruikt voor publicaties waar enkel de auteurswet op van toepassing is.
Samenvatting
Ik heb mijn afstudeeropdracht voor Avans Hogeschool te Breda voltooid bij Van Beek Informatica BV. VBIBV is een informaticabedrijf in Valkenswaard dat zich met name richt op softwareontwikkeling in de beveiligingssector, met onder andere het meldkamersysteem AACS en het incidentregistratiesysteem Eirys. Hiernaast ontwikkelt het echter ook software voor monitoring in de breedste zin van het woord, van temperatuur- en druksensors tot beveiligingscamera's.
Mijn opdracht betrof het ontwerpen en ontwikkelen van een systeem voor monitoring en analyse van meetgegevens die via het lichtnet verstuurd worden.
VBIBV is door Rational Products benaderd om dit systeem te ontwikkelen voor hun lichtnetapparatuur. Deze apparatuur bestaat uit Segment Builders, de centrale koppelpunten van het netwerk, en dataloggers waarmee de Segment Builders kunnen communiceren en gegevens uit kunnen wisselen via het lichtnet.
De oriëntatiefase is benut om kennis op te bouwen van de apparatuur van Rational Products en het inrichten van een lichtnet-netwerk. Hierbij is gekeken naar de situaties die bij de gebruikspatronen van de klanten van Rational Products het meest van toepassing zullen zijn. Ook is hierbij onderzocht welke softwarearchitectuur het meest geschikt is voor de ontwikkeling van het systeem.
Als ontwikkelmethodiek is voor de Agile-methode Scrum gekozen. Hierbij is gebruik gemaakt van korte sprints, om de tijd tussen ontwikkelfasen en feedback zo kort mogelijk te houden. Hierdoor is de kans op tijdrovende wijzigingen later in het traject verkleind.
Het ontwikkelen van de software ging niet zonder problemen. Met name het ontwikkelen van een betrouwbare driver voor seriële communicatie had meer voeten in aarde dan aanvankelijk gedacht. Hierbij kwam nog de uitdaging om een gebruikersinterface te ontwikkelen die een complex systeem op een eenvoudige manier aan de gebruiker kan presenteren, zonder dat hierbij functionaliteit verloren gaat.
Terugkijkend op dit project kan ik met zekerheid stellen dat ik erg veel geleerd heb, zowel op technisch gebied als op het gebied van projectorganisatie en ontwikkelmethodiek. Toch heb ik nog bijna elke dag het gevoel bij te kunnen en moeten leren om zeker te kunnen zijn van de kwaliteit van het werk dat ik aflever. Hierbij is het minstens zo belangrijk om zelfstandig problemen te kunnen analyseren en hiervoor oplossingen te bedenken als het is om bepaalde technieken in de praktijk toe te kunnen passen.

Organisatie | Avans Hogeschool |
Afdeling | AIB Academie voor ICT en Business |
Partners | Van Beek Informatica BV |
Datum | 2013-06-01 |
Type | Bachelor |
Taal | Nederlands |